Authoring and presenting 3D presentations in augmented reality
First Claim
1. A method for authoring three dimensional (“
- 3D”
) presentations, the method comprising;
generating a virtual 3D environment comprising a virtual representation of a physical presentation room and 3D assets;
generating a 3D presentation that choreographs behaviors of the 3D assets into a plurality of scenes of the 3D presentation, wherein the 3D presentation comprises behavior parameters for the behaviors recorded using a 3D interface and a 2D interface operationally integrated for spatial authoring, wherein spatial authoring supports a first co-author using the 3D interface to simultaneously co-author with a second co-author using the 2D interface; and
providing the 3D presentation for coordinated rendering, among a plurality of author devices in the presentation room, of 3D images of the 3D assets and corresponding behaviors.
1 Assignment
0 Petitions
Accused Products
Abstract
Various methods and systems are provided for authoring and presenting 3D presentations. Generally, an augmented or virtual reality device for each author, presenter and audience member includes 3D presentation software. During authoring mode, one or more authors can use 3D and/or 2D interfaces to generate a 3D presentation that choreographs behaviors of 3D assets into scenes and beats. During presentation mode, the 3D presentation is loaded in each user device, and 3D images of the 3D assets and corresponding asset behaviors are rendered among the user devices in a coordinated manner. As such, one or more presenters can navigate the scenes and beats of the 3D presentation to deliver the 3D presentation to one or more audience members wearing augmented reality headsets.
10 Citations
20 Claims
-
1. A method for authoring three dimensional (“
- 3D”
) presentations, the method comprising;generating a virtual 3D environment comprising a virtual representation of a physical presentation room and 3D assets; generating a 3D presentation that choreographs behaviors of the 3D assets into a plurality of scenes of the 3D presentation, wherein the 3D presentation comprises behavior parameters for the behaviors recorded using a 3D interface and a 2D interface operationally integrated for spatial authoring, wherein spatial authoring supports a first co-author using the 3D interface to simultaneously co-author with a second co-author using the 2D interface; and providing the 3D presentation for coordinated rendering, among a plurality of author devices in the presentation room, of 3D images of the 3D assets and corresponding behaviors. - View Dependent Claims (2, 3, 4, 5, 6, 7)
- 3D”
-
8. One or more computer storage media storing computer-useable instructions that, when used by one or more computing devices, cause the one or more computing devices to perform operations comprising:
-
generating a virtual three-dimensional (“
3D”
) environment comprising a virtual representation of a physical presentation room and 3D assets;receiving a 3D presentation that choreographs behaviors of the 3D assets into a plurality of scenes of the 3D presentation, wherein the 3D presentation comprises behavior parameters for the behaviors stored in the 3D presentation in association with the corresponding scenes and pre-recorded using a 3D interface and a 2D interface operationally integrated for spatial authoring, wherein each of the scenes defines a particular arrangement of the 3D assets and the behaviors; and providing for coordinated rendering, among a presenter device and a plurality of audience devices in the presentation room, of 3D images of the 3D assets and corresponding behaviors in accordance with navigational commands from the presenter device navigating the scenes of the 3D presentation.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A computer system comprising:
-
one or more hardware processors and memory configured to provide computer program instructions to the one or more hardware processors; a three-dimensional (“
3D”
) environment generator configured to utilize the one or more hardware processors to generate a virtual 3D environment comprising a virtual representation of a physical presentation room and 3D assets;an authoring component configured to utilize the one or more hardware processors to generate a 3D presentation that choreographs behaviors of the 3D assets into a plurality of scenes of the 3D presentation, wherein at least one of the scenes comprises a plurality of beats, wherein the 3D presentation comprises behavior parameters for the behaviors pre-recorded using a 3D interface and a 2D interface operationally integrated for spatial authoring; and a presentation component configured to utilize the one or more hardware processors to provide the 3D presentation for coordinated rendering, among a presenter device and a plurality of audience devices in the presentation room, of 3D images of the 3D assets and corresponding behaviors.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ification